Kaizer Chiefs midfielder Mduduzi Shabalala has made a surprising revelation about his football loyalty. The star player used to be an avid supporter of Orlando Pirates, but now he swears he will remain a die-hard Amakhosi fan for the rest of his life.

From Bucs to Amakhosi

Shabalala grew up in a household where everyone supported Orlando Pirates. He idolised Pirates forward Thembinkosi Lorch, and his family’s love for the team was evident. However, things took a dramatic turn when Shabalala joined Kaizer Chiefs. He had to switch his allegiance to his new team, and now he says he will “die a Chiefs fan”.

Shabalala recalls his first Soweto Derby experience, which took place around 2019 or 2020. He remembers how Chiefs were leading 1-0, only for Lorch to equalise after a pass from Ben Motshwari. At the time, he was still a Pirates supporter, but his loyalty has since shifted to Chiefs. He has even managed to convince his mother and siblings to join him in supporting the team, although his father remains stubbornly loyal to Pirates.

Pirates’ Title Hopes

Orlando Pirates are still in the running for the Betway Premiership title, but they face a tough challenge in their final match against Orbit College. Pirates need to win to take the title, while Orbit are fighting to avoid relegation. The hosts have a strong incentive to win, as a victory could see them climb out of the relegation playoff slot. Pirates should expect a fierce battle from Orbit, who will be “scrapping for their lives”.
